As the Customer Support Administrator,, Fleet Delivery you will be responsible for working with Element's network of delivering fleet vehicle dealers to answer questions and resolve issues around new vehicle deliveries.

You will obtain status on new vehicle deliveries and obtain delivery dates to drives revenue.


A Day in the Life Adding notes to the system and status tracker- Resolving any problems the dealer is having with delivery- Interact with others as necessary to research and resolve issues.- Maintain accurate and up to date records on the status of unresolved issues- Service Clouds (cases) - many questions (status, move request, temp tag expiring, damage, install status, etc)- Returned fax letters from the dealer advising status- Factory Follow up- Take appropriate action to resolve issues delaying the receipt of invoices or delivery of vehicles.
